Best Conservatory Repair: A Comprehensive Guide
Conservatories, likewise called sun parlors or glass rooms, are a popular addition to numerous homes, offering a space that bridges the space between indoor and outdoor living. Nevertheless, like any structure, conservatories require regular maintenance and periodic repairs to ensure they stay practical, safe, and aesthetically pleasing. This extensive guide will explore the best practices for conservatory repair, from recognizing common issues to performing effective solutions.
Understanding Common Conservatory Issues
Before diving into the repair process, it's necessary to comprehend the typical issues that conservatories face. These can range from small cosmetic issues to more substantial structural issues. Here are a few of the most regular issues:
Leaking Roofs and Windows
Causes: Poor sealing, damaged glazing, or worn-out rubber gaskets.Signs: Water stains on the ceiling, dampness, or puddles on the floor.
Structural Damage
Causes: Age, weather direct exposure, or poor setup.Signs: Cracks in the frame, loose panels, or creaking sounds.
Condensation
Causes: Insufficient ventilation, poor insulation, or high humidity.Symptoms: Foggy windows, damp surfaces, and mold development.
Fading or Discoloration
Causes: UV exposure, severe climate condition, or low-quality materials.Symptoms: Yellowing of the frame, peeling paint, or tarnished glass.
Faulty Doors and Windows
Causes: Wear and tear, misalignment, or damaged hardware.Signs: Difficulty opening or closing, drafts, or rattling.Steps to Identify and Address Conservatory Issues
Routine Inspections
Conduct a thorough inspection of your conservatory a minimum of twice a year. Examine for any signs of damage, wear, or wear and tear.
Check Seals and Gaskets
Take a look at the seals around doors and windows. Replace any that are split, used, or no longer offer a tight seal.
Examine Structural Integrity
Look for any indications of structural damage, such as cracks or loose panels. If you see any issues, it's important to address them immediately to prevent further damage.
Assess Insulation and Ventilation
Guarantee that your conservatory has appropriate insulation and ventilation. Poor insulation can lead to condensation and energy loss, while inadequate ventilation can trigger moisture and mold growth.
Tidy and Maintain
Regular cleansing can assist prevent lots of typical issues. Utilize a moderate detergent and water to clean up the glass and frames. For more persistent spots, consider utilizing a specialized cleansing solution.Best Practices for Conservatory Repair
Roof and Window Leaks
Immediate Action: Place pails or towels to catch water and avoid damage to the flooring.Long-Term Solution: Re-seal or change damaged glazing and rubber gaskets. Consider utilizing a high-quality sealant designed for conservatories.
Structural Repairs

Condensation Management
Immediate Action: Use dehumidifiers or fans to decrease moisture levels.Long-Term Solution: Install additional ventilation, such as trickle vents or a mechanical ventilation system. Think about updating to double or triple-glazed windows for much better insulation.
Fading and Discoloration
Immediate Action: Apply a protective finishing to the impacted areas.Long-Term Solution: Replace any severely damaged or tarnished parts. Choose high-quality, UV-resistant products for future installations.
Faulty Doors and Windows
Immediate Action: Lubricate hinges and tracks to improve functionality.Long-Term Solution: Replace any damaged hardware and ensure that doors and windows are effectively lined up. Consider upgrading to more resilient and energy-efficient alternatives.When to Call a Professional
While numerous conservatory repairs can be handled by house owners, there are times when professional support is needed. Here are some scenarios where it's best to hire a professional:
Structural Damage: If you observe substantial fractures or damage to the frame, a professional can examine the extent of the damage and advise the best repair method.Complex Repairs: For issues that need specialized tools or know-how, such as replacing large sections of the roof or windows, a professional can make sure the task is done properly and safely.Service warranty Issues: If your conservatory is still under service warranty, a professional can help you browse the guarantee procedure and ensure that repairs are covered.FAQs
Q: How typically should I check my conservatory?A: It's recommended to examine your conservatory a minimum of two times a year, preferably in the spring and fall, to capture any issues before they become major problems.
Q: Can I fix a leaking roof myself?A: Minor leaks can typically be fixed with a great sealant, however more significant issues may require professional assistance to guarantee the repair works and long-lasting.
Q: What can I do to prevent condensation in my conservatory?A: Improving ventilation and insulation are crucial. Consider installing drip vents, utilizing dehumidifiers, and upgrading to double or triple-glazed windows.
Q: How do I select the ideal materials for my conservatory repair?A: Look for high-quality, UV-resistant materials that are appropriate for the particular conditions of your conservatory. Seek advice from a professional to guarantee you make the best choices.
Q: Is it cost-effective to repair a conservatory, or should I think about replacing it?A: The cost-effectiveness of repair versus replacement depends upon the degree of the damage. Minor repairs are typically more economical, but if the damage is comprehensive, replacement may be the much better long-lasting solution.
Preserving and repairing your conservatory is necessary to ensure it stays a functional and enjoyable part of your home. By understanding typical issues, following best practices, and understanding when to contact a professional, you can keep your conservatory in leading condition for many years to come. Routine maintenance and timely repairs can assist you prevent more substantial issues and ensure that your conservatory continues to offer a stunning and comfy space for your household to enjoy.
